vertical menu and submenu in html examples

vertical menu and submenu in html examples

Simple menus using CSS3 and HTML5 are becoming quite popular because you dont need JQuery or JavaScript to add animations. Tuts+ have published afour part seriesthat explores a number of responsive navigation patterns. The cookies store information anonymously and assign a randomly generated number to identify unique visitors. This cookie is installed by Google Analytics. Save my name, email, and website in this browser for the next time I comment. Youll notice a light green tab that, when clicked, heightens the top navigation bar so links can be seen. Your email address will not be published. height: auto; The focus of this super basic horizontal bar menu is on usability. On smaller screens this same effect holds true, but the menu appears vertically instead of horizontally. Many thanks, gr8 collection man thank you for sharing , this is very useful for me. 11:59 am, I wan to have a close(X) in the main menu. How to fetch data from JSON file and display in HTML table using jQuery ? Thank you for a useful info, have a good resource in your blog. what about accessibility (508) and JAWS reading submenu items? 1:07 pm. vijay This is really awesome.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Created by Takane Ichinose, this full-page navigation menu, makes use of the pages typography and icons as large images. Roberto Used to track the information of the embedded YouTube videos on a website. really nice tutorial .but i can not find such type menu those i want.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, How to make Twitter Bootstrap menu dropdown on hover rather than click. it will be so usefull 2 me. nice information. you can see drop down menu width background image example. }); Istiaq Hasan 8:10 am. Discover CSS snippets for vertical and horizontal navs with dropdowns, slideouts and also some animated menu systems. Firebug also does report an uncaught exception. February 26, 2015 @ There were moments when I initially started out making use of the program, and I thought it was way too complicated. Free Web Design Code & Scripts - CodeHim is one of the BEST developer websites that provide web designers and developers with a simple way to preview and download a variety of free code & scripts. Load the jQuery and Bootstrap CSS in the head tag of your HTML page. This classic design style focuses on equal-width links for the navigation bar. 1. CSS3 Flexbox is a term used by developers to reference the flexible model of CSS3 layouts. The problem is that it shows up in all subpages, not only the one were I inserted it. June 12, 2015 @ JHARAPHULA ($60) | VEDAMALHAR ($10) Accept, FREE Signup and Publish with 3+ yrs Old Blog | DA 63+, My Love Says it Seems like GOPA. What is the difference between CSS and SCSS ? to download them. However, the code/info for #8 slide-down menu doesn't work. i have question for you !!! They are html evil incarnate! But If Have 7 items or more what will be necessary change? 2023 JHARAPHULA, ALL RIGHTS RESERVED. We are disclosing this in accordance with the Federal Trade Commission's 16 CFR, Part 255: "Guides Concerning the Use of Endorsements and Testimonials in Advertising" and also in accordance to amazon associates programme operating agreement. Take note of the beautiful animation effect which is controlled through a CSS.activeclass. These cookies track visitors across websites and collect information to provide customized ads. Can you help me. or

element. Can you please help me, if the sub menu has more items than the parent menu.. then the sub menu list gets truncated, it shows only the no of items equal to parent menu item. Also you will find some useful tutorials at the end of this post where you can use to start building your own multilevel navigation menu. like for example parent menu is for categories, sub menu shows the different items in the categories and when you hover over the item, another single line height tab opens up with the price tag or something, thank you very much! The animated highlight must be set to match the selection to work properly. Advertisement cookies are used to provide visitors with relevant ads and marketing campaigns. I have book marked it keep posting. Application menus are implemented similarly, but with additional WAI-ARIA markup. Once the browser is shortened the nav is hidden behind a toggle link. Wrap a

element around the button and the
to position the Now, style the menu by adding the following CSS styles into your project. Regards Frankie. This menu is designed using JQuery & CSS. Navigation menu are greatly important for usability purposes and creating a user-friendly website. The transition animations are based on CSS. This is very important for the success of a business. Use fly-out (or drop-down) menus to provide an overview of a web sites page hierarchy. I am thinking of moving everything on the top page, even if that would encompass a duplication, but I am not sure it will work. rev2023.3.3.43278. For some, it might be impossible. Create excellent website navigability with this beautiful, responsive and free transparent menu template. Made by Thibault D, this features an overlay menu with CSS animations. 10:27 pm. Same with beer. Thanks for contributing an answer to Stack Overflow! thanks my friend :). By hovering over one of the options, a dropdown menu appears, giving more choices. thank u. Michelle L Smith This hamburger menu by Virgil Pana folds over a background website to give a clearer idea of what it looks like in real life. Developed with support from the WAI-ACT project, co-funded by the European Commission IST Programme. Heres yet another example of a fully customized webapp. Designed and coded by alphardex, the text of the menu items fills in blue when hovering over them with the mouse pointer. thanks again!!! how can i get it ??? An option for every use, i was just looking at these at work today.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Despite the name, click events are activated regardless of the input method as soon as the link gets activated. -, A Quick Guide on How to Change App Icons on iOS 16 -. National Geographic photographer Kiliii Yyan shared his best tips for phone photography. This is used to present users with ads that are relevant to them according to the user profile. The cookie is used to calculate visitor, session, campaign data and keep track of site usage for the site's analytics report. (adsbygoogle=window.adsbygoogle||[]).push({}); Shared resources may suffice in the early stages of a small business. Web-developers can create user-friendly horizontal or vertical navigation menus using CSS. Thanks in advance, ali imarn We will demonstratea quick way to createa nice, clean vertical menu with a sub menu which slides out. The cookies is used to store the user consent for the cookies in the category "Necessary". Dependencies: -. UI Developer Interview Questions for Experienced Professionals. First thank you for your blog and yours tutorials. The cookie is used to store and identify a users' unique session ID for the purpose of managing user session on the website. As a Multi Niche platform we have spend several years for Collecting various useful Stories. It has tabs like Home, About Us, Service, News & Career. Thought i'd spice things up a bit! Were you able to figure it out? Celine put together this full responsive portfolio layout which incorporates a simple yet efficient navigation bar. Alberto Leon created this vertical CSS menu with a dark theme.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); This site uses Akismet to reduce spam. Yet moving beyond the design we find an exceptional responsive dropdown. These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c. Make sure you are running this example in presence of internet. I was looking all around the web for this. They then use jQuery to add a class to whichever menu should be visible. I tried to hide it in the buttons changin page but it only works when clicking the buttom where is the control, even if I included the ajax files even in the other panel. Pure.CSS comes up with very simple vertical and horizontal menus that can be easily customized by the developer. great! This interesting design is put at the top of the page, which is a smart trick to prevent people from opening the menu by mistake. Although responsivity should be applied to every part of a layout, the navigation menu is one area that deserves extra attention. It also features a top bar with social media icons and multi-level drop-down menu layering. Horizontal menu's are place in header or footer while vertical menu can placed aside the content pan. Javascript makes it possible to create more interactive, more responsive and more flexible navigation to any website. These useful snippets are perfect for designers to seize and use as a launchpad for other web projects. The swinging panels come down to reveal additional categories. An example of a nested dropdown with the submenu expanding on the left side instead of the right side. Youll find vertical and horizontal navs with dropdowns and slideouts and all kinds of animation effects. 9:06 pm. jQuery(.submenu).parent().css({position: relative}); 5 Reasons Why Outdoor Play is essential for Kids, Understanding the benefits of Lumigan Eye Drops, Diastema Understanding the Causes of Gap in Front Teeth. It has beautiful color changes and animated dropdown menus. Center a column using Twitter Bootstrap 3. so please give me some notes for java script Your email address will not be published. Clicking the three horizontal dots at the top unfolds the animated menu by Mikael Ainalem. This cookie is used by Vimeo. This tutorial explains how to implement a simple vertical menu digg-like using CSS and javascript to show/hide sub-menu. :-). A hamburger toggle opens & closes the responsive nav in a vertical fashion. The width of each option adapts to the size of the screen. Christian Sanchez thanks, I was looking for drop down menu and I found this list :). Jose Marin This could be a useful template for any single-page layout with the added bonus of Batman-approved animations. This simple menu has a neat effect by hovering over the links, and opens a submenu with an accordion. Each
  • element is floated left and has a min-width so they are equal in size. I should say that single level drop downs are ok and in many places a good design choice, just avoid taking them multi-level. When these tabs are resized smaller they behave like a regular block-level navigation with animation effects. Thank you this has me very helped.useful list. While the class enable is added to li element, sub-menu for that node is getting visible. simply good!!!!!!!!! cool !! It gets even better as you give options The cookies is used to store the user consent for the cookies in the category "Non-necessary". Doing so unfolds the icon-based menu. Very good explanation. Lets get a little experimental with this animated morphing circle navigation. Everything has been coded using pure HTML/CSS and it even supports multi-level dropdown menus. For off-line version please replace the JQuery CDN link with local reference. How to do this? How can I make Bootstrap columns all the same height? The menu expands when scrolling down the page. Stphanie Walter created this responsive horizontal menu bar with sublevels using CSS. WoW your clients by creating innovative and response-boosting websitesfast with no coding experience. On Mouseover how to Highlight ASP.NET Gridview Selected Row, Jquery function to Generate Random font Size & Color Anchor Tags, Advanced CSS3 Interview Questions and Answers. Thanks for sharing this tut.. Using an unordered list, to display a hierarchical structure of a complexity that would be very hard to achieve with dynamic select boxes. 3.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. High performance 60 FPS animations where the menu morphs into a full-screen vertical menu. This menu is designed using JQuery & CSS. Also, I would like to know what change is required to make the height of the submenu be as tall as the filled elements and not the same height of the entire parent menu. Horizontal menus are place in header or footer while vertical menu can placed aside the content pan. March 4, 2017 @ Vertical navigation, also known as the vertical sidebar or vertical navbar, is a navigation menu component stretching along the side of a page to present all links that will take users to different pages or parts of a website or mobile app. The following responsive code snippets are perfect for any type of layout. Someone else provided this code. The WAI-ARIA markup aria-expanded="false" declares that the submenu navigation is presently hidden, or collapsed. Example 3: In this example, we will create demonstrate Vertical Menu with multiple Submenus. Larger websites, such as those for magazines, have more complicated menus. In this example I designed a jquery vertical menu for my Corporate website. With an impressive Ajax interface, you can build your own CSS drop down DHTML sub-menu in minutes without writing a single line of code. For this reason sliding drawers should be used sparingly, primarily when a site has a lengthy navigation. Dream to establish a domain where from you can get all your day today required information. Click on an item to open. What are the Features of Dedicated Hosting? 3:17 am. Open CodePen. It was made by Patak. While using W3Schools, you agree to have read and accepted our. I'm still trying Henry Toringe When the nav is resized users can click an icon next to certain links that display internal sub-menus. I have downloaded your scriptaculous multi level dropdown menu and converted it for my website donsgarden.co.uk. Trademarks and brands are the property of their respective owners. everything in one place - great share! The fly-out functionality is created using CSS and scripting with slightly separate considerations for mouse and keyboard users. my requirement s over. I write from Spain.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ari. A jQuery nested menus, based on dynamic AJAX responses. Thanks for creating such a nice and clean css for us. The Drop Down Menu Generator is great. Dreamweaver has been lately my personal goto application for years. Although it doesnt have glam, the menu works and runs with the highest level of usability in mind. This is a pure CSS menu, coded in CSS by Erin McKinney. Application menus are implemented similarly, but with additional WAI-ARIA markup. Design a Vertical and Horizontal menu using Pure CSS, Pure CSS Responsive Horizontal-to-Vertical Menu Layout. I have this website with a broken css verticle menu that is three levels deep. This is a menu based on an unordered list (
    • ). February 27, 2015 @ these are some awesome menu tutorials. 9:20 pm, Hello i have a question, what can i do if a menu has much more submenus than the number of menus, example 8 or 10 or 12 submenus in a menu, amene Make sure to provide other ways to reach the submenu items, for example by repeating them on the page of the parent menu item. thanks. subnav menu correctly with CSS. Get certifiedby completinga course today! Above all, Yyan said it's important to stick around and immerse yourself in the environment. it. How to create Vertical Menu using HTML and CSS ? 8:46 am. This snippet offers a lot of flexibility and would fit perfectly into any website. Nice tutorial here, I use Dreamweaver for web design and in My opinion, sub categories navigation is not so good looking in vertical menu. Ajay Kamat. One of them happens to be exactly what I'm looking for. The different options are indicated with icons. 4.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Instead, consider one of the following approaches. I think the important thing is not to FORCE a user to use multi-level navigation. I developed the menu on a local copy using Mongrel, Ruby 1.8.7, Rails 2.3.4, Scriptaculous 1.8.3, Prototype 1.6.0.1. This site is protected by reCAPTCHA and the Google, Web graphic designer, kanpur web designer, logo design india, Multilevel Drop Down Navigation Menus: Examples and Tutorials, Fancy Sliding Tab Menu using script.aculo.us, Dropdownmenu made with scriptaculous/prototype. It is made by Jouan Marcel. The following code iterates through all top-level items with the class has-submenu and adds a click event, which opens or closes the submenu depending on its state. PA. You are right. Sub menus are places with nested ul element inside the corresponding li element. Christian Sanchez Thks, Your email address will not be published. Do you like to present your Stories near Quality Audiences? At first glance this menu seems pretty generic: traditional links, hamburger sliding nav, and flat color scheme. This is a clean CSS menu by Rock Starwind. Heres an interesting recreation of the navigation effect found onMic.com. Vertical Menu is the buttons arranged in the vertical menu bar/navbar. Upon clicking the horizontal three bar icon, a small menu fans out. It is easy to implement, and has been tested in Internet Explorer 6+, Firefox, Safari, and Chrome. Create A Subnav Step 1) Add HTML: Example <!-- Load font awesome icons -->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7./css/font-awesome.min.css"> <!-- The navigation menu --> <div class="navbar"> <a href="#home"> Home </a> <div class="subnav"> It has tabs like Home, About Us, Service, News & Career. Menus are the main tools for visitors to navigate throughout a website. Types of CSS (Cascading Style Sheet) Styling. I need number 8 but After that, create the HTML nav element and arrange navigation links in unordered list. My website host server is using Ruby 1.8.6 and Rails 2.2.2. Tips for Choosing an Android and iOS App Development Company, Digital Elevator Ads The Evolution of Branding and Marketing, 7 best Digital Marketing Skills for SEO Managers to Play, 7 Tips to help your Small Business with Digital Marketing Strategies, Dominate your Competitors with these 6 SEO Strategies, 15 Actionable SEO Tips for Small Businesses to boost SERP ranking. The nav links expand into view but instead of coming out form the toggle icon they slide in from offscreen. . All the menu links have a subtle animation effect on them when the menu is opened and closed. Ive wrote a lots of code but I never tried css. Follow us on social media to be updated with latest web design code & scripts Bootstrap Vertical Menu with Submenu on Click, Off Canvas Menu with Submenu - jQuery Pushy, Vertical Animated Menu with CSS3 and jQuery, Bootstrap Jumbotron with Image Background, Bootstrap Collapsible Panel with Up/Down Arrow Icon, Bootstrap eCommerce Product List with Navbar & Hover, Bootstrap Multi Step Form with Progress Bar, jQuery Lightbox Gallery with Thumbnails mBox, Confirm Box in jQuery with Yes No option Zebra Dialog, jQuery News Ticker Horizontal Bar with AJAX Support, Bootstrap Notification Bar with Close Button, Embed YouTube Video as Background with jQuery, jQuery Header Notification Bar with a Simple Plugin, Bootstrap Context Menu with Submenu on Right Click, Responsive Hamburger Menu with jQuery & CSS, Simple Quiz Application with Timer using JavaScript, Bootstrap Multiselect Dropdown with Checkboxes, 25+ Best JavaScript Shopping Cart Examples with Demo, Bootstrap 5 Buttons with Icon and Text Tutorial & Demo, Bootstrap Select Dropdown with Search Box Tutorial & Examples, Bootstrap 5 Sidebar Menu with Submenu Collapse/Hover Tutorial Demo, Bootstrap 4 Modal Popup Login Form Tutorial & Demo, Bootstrap 5 Mega Menu Responsive Examples. Make a div horizontally scrollable using CSS. I am using jGlideMenu that seems to work seamlessly but for a very annoying and blocking issue. Hello, I just noticed that when you put a link on one of the sub-item/child item of the dropdown, it's not working. This seemingly simple navigation bar is full of nice CSS effects. Thanks codingguys, i used your css vertical menu on my website. It does not correspond to any user ID in the web application and does not store any personally identifiable information. Although Im not totally sure why this is called the Batman Nav, its definitely the hero we all deserve. You must set the z-index to -1 so that the menu is underneath the parent menu. Is there a single-word adjective for "having exceptionally strong moral principles"? This cookie is used for storing the unique ID which is used for identifying the user's device, on their revisit to the websites which uses same ad network. Used by Google DoubleClick and stores information about how the user uses the website and any other advertisement before visiting the website. Strategies, standards, and supporting resources to make the Web accessible to people with disabilities. Initial all sub-menus are hided. The menu converts into a large block which animates into view when toggled. It gets even better as you give options, I love your website tutorial its very educate. Now I am looking for having marked an item from main menu at time of going to the second one, and having one item marked from the first and second at time of selecting one from the 3rd one (when i say marked, is selected or background color) Once the layout becomes too small the links hide away behind a toggle menu. By clicking the hamburger icon in the top left, a selection of purple bubbles appears with the options. So if the user doesn't want to deal with the menus, they can bypass them and be taken to a wizard-like page instead. The cookie is a session cookies and is deleted when all the browser windows are closed. But I like them as drop down in horizontal navigation. We are one among vastly growing leading information based portal. here a link for another jQuery menu: Thank for this article, is very util for my new project. I have the same problem. Functional cookies help to perform certain functionalities like sharing the content of the website on social media platforms, collect feedbacks, and other third-party features. Its not exactly practical but it can be restyled and put into creative projects or web portfolios. Thanks, Fabrizio Bartolomucci, I love your website tutorial its very educate. your help is highly appreciated.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? This is a dropdown menu that was coded in CSS by steven. When we hover over the parent
    • we show the
  • vertical menu and submenu in html examples